What is a Bay Window?
A bay window is a combination of 3 or more window systems that extend beyond the exterior wall of a home. Usually, Windows And Doors R Us includes a large central window flanked by two smaller ones at an angle, producing a "bay" or nook. This architectural function has ended up being popular in residential designs for its capability to boost visual interest and develop a sense of spaciousness inside.

The Importance of Skilled Installers
1. Precision and Accuracy
The installation of bay windows requires precision, as an inaccurate measurement can cause an improperly fitting window, drafts, and increased energy expenses. Skilled installers use professional tools and methods to make sure that everything is measured and fitted to excellence.
2. Structural Integrity
Bay windows require appropriate anchoring to keep the structure's integrity. Qualified installers have the knowledge to comprehend local building regulations and requirements, making sure that the installation adheres to security standards and won't jeopardize the home's structural soundness.
3. Avoiding Common Pitfalls
Common concerns during bay window installation consist of water leakages, inadequate insulation, and bad finishing. Experienced installers prepare for potential pitfalls and can mitigate them efficiently, saving house owners from costly repairs down the roadway.
4. Visual Appeal
Aesthetically pleasing installations take skill. Specialists comprehend how to align window units for maximum visual impact, guaranteeing that the bay window boosts the home's general design.

The Installation Process: What to Expect
Comprehending the installation process can assist property owners feel more comfortable and notified when engaging with skilled bay window installers.
The Typical Installation Process Includes:
-
Initial Consultation
- Discuss choices, designs, and budget with the installers.
-
Site Evaluation
- A comprehensive evaluation of the window opening and structural integrity.
-
Measuring and Ordering
- Accurate measurements are taken to buy the appropriate size bay window.
-
Preparation
- Eliminating the old window (if applicable) and preparing the opening.
-
Installation
- Proficient installation of the bay window units, guaranteeing everything is level and properly sealed.
-
Completing Touches
- Exterior and interior trim work to develop a polished look.
-
Final Inspection
- A comprehensive walk-through to guarantee the installation fulfills the property owner's fulfillment and quality requirements.
FAQs about Bay Window Installation
Q1: Can I install a bay window myself?
While it is possible to install a bay window yourself, it is recommended to work with skilled installers to make sure proper fitting, sealing, and structural integrity.
Q2: How long does it take to install a bay window?
The installation process typically takes in between a few hours to a couple of days, depending on the intricacy of the job.
Q3: What are the expenses associated with bay window installation?
Expenses can differ commonly based upon window size, materials, and installation intricacy. Typically, house owners can expect to spend between ₤ 1,000 and ₤ 5,000.
Q4: Are there particular licenses required for bay window installation?
Authorizations may be required depending upon local structure guidelines. Skilled installers will usually manage this aspect and make sure compliance.
Q5: Do bay windows require special maintenance?
Bay windows require regular cleansing and checks for sealing and insulation. It's best to schedule periodic professional inspections to guarantee longevity.
